Output 53f39a5c28b99c66192dd17dd18d93f565f26127177c9484b545d48fbe581094:1

value
20342446
script pubkey
OP_0 OP_PUSHBYTES_32 de4c8d3914887d5a6fdacfcefbbb136dead505514215cf5fbb0141ff08dec0b6
address
bc1qmexg6wg53p745m76el80hwcndh4d2p23gg2u7hamq9ql7zx7czmqwx0uf8
transaction
53f39a5c28b99c66192dd17dd18d93f565f26127177c9484b545d48fbe581094